Which country has the most powerful cyber attacks?

A recent global cybercrime assessment reveals a complex threat landscape. Russia leads, closely followed by Ukraine, China, the US, and Nigeria; these nations consistently demonstrate high-level capabilities across all assessed threat vectors. The study underscores the widespread and sophisticated nature of modern cyberattacks.

Unraveling the Shadowy Cyberwarfare Landscape: A Global Perspective

In the ever-evolving digital realm, cyberattacks have emerged as a potent force, shaping geopolitical dynamics and posing significant threats to nations worldwide. A recent comprehensive global assessment sheds light on this complex threat landscape, revealing a startling ranking of countries with the most formidable cyber arsenal.

The Cyber Powerhouse: Russia Emerges as Dominant Force

Topping the list is Russia, a formidable cyber powerhouse with a history of orchestrating sophisticated attacks against adversaries. The nation boasts a highly skilled workforce and advanced infrastructure, enabling it to execute complex cyber campaigns with precision and effectiveness. From infiltrating critical infrastructure to manipulating elections, Russia’s cyber capabilities have garnered global attention.

Ukraine: A Determined Combatant on the Cyberfront

Surprising many, Ukraine ranks second in the assessment, a testament to its resilience and determination in the face of ongoing cyber warfare with Russia. With a tech-savvy population and support from international partners, Ukraine has developed robust cyber defense mechanisms and launched counterattacks against Russian aggression, demonstrating its growing prowess in the digital battlefield.

China: A Technological Giant with Latent Cyber Might

China, a global leader in technology, emerges as the third-most powerful cyber actor. The nation possesses immense resources and a burgeoning cyber warfare apparatus that has garnered significant attention. While its cyber capabilities remain largely cloaked in secrecy, China is believed to possess advanced offensive and defensive technologies, making it a prominent player in the cyber arena.

United States: A Global Watchdog with Cyber Arsenal

The United States, a long-standing superpower, ranks fourth in the assessment. As a global watchdog, the US has a vast cyber apparatus dedicated to protecting national security and countering malicious actors. Its investment in research and development has resulted in advanced cyber capabilities that allow it to deter and respond to threats from both state and non-state actors.

Nigeria: A Surprising Up-and-Comer in Cybercrime

Nigeria, a nation not often associated with cyber prowess, unexpectedly ranks fifth in the assessment. Its inclusion underscores the growing sophistication of cybercrime on a global scale. Nigerian cybercriminals have become notorious for their intricate scams, ransomware attacks, and financial fraud, demonstrating their ability to exploit vulnerabilities in the digital ecosystem.
